What is a Cooker Hob?

A cooker hob, likewise understood simply as a stovetop, is the surface area on which pots and pans are put to prepare food. It can be powered by gas, electrical power, or induction technology. Cooker hobs can be found in numerous types and sizes, dealing with different cooking styles and choices.

Kinds Of Cooker Hobs

TypeDescriptionProsCons
Gas HobUtilizes gas flames to heat pots and pans.Instantaneous heat, precise temperature controlRequires gas line, less energy-efficient
Electric HobUtilizes electric coils or a smooth glass-ceramic surface area.Easy to clean and preserveSlower to heat and cool down
Induction HobUtilizes electromagnetic energy to heat pots and pans directly.Quick cooking, energy-efficientPricey, requires suitable pots and pans

What is an Oven?

An oven is a kitchen home appliance used for baking, roasting, and broiling. Like hobs, ovens can be powered by gas, electrical power, or perhaps microwaves. They are important for preparing a large range of dishes and frequently come with different features that boost cooking capabilities.

Types of Ovens

TypeDescriptionProsCons
Standard OvenUtilizes gas or electrical aspects to heat the within.Versatile and commonly availableUneven heating can take place
Convection OvenUses a fan to distribute hot air for even cooking.Cooks food faster and more uniformlyCan be more expensive than standard
Microwave OvenUses electro-magnetic radiation to prepare food quickly.Fast cooking, great for reheatingMinimal browning and crisping capability
Wall OvenBuilt into the wall, releasing up cooking area area.Visually pleasing and space-savingSetup can be challenging

Picking the Right Combo of Cooker Hob and Oven

When selecting a combination of cooker hob and oven, a number of factors must be considered to guarantee the best fit for your cooking practices and kitchen space.

Factors to Consider

  1. Cooking Style: Assess your cooking preferences-- do you typically bake, or do you rely more on stovetop cooking?
  2. Kitchen area Space: Consider the design of your kitchen and how much area you have for appliances.
  3. Budget plan: Determine your spending plan as rates can vary greatly based upon brand name and features.
  4. Ease of Cleaning: Evaluate the cleaning requirements of the systems. Smooth-top hobs, for circumstances, are simpler to clean than standard ones.
  5. Energy Efficiency: Choose energy-efficient designs to decrease your energy costs and environmental impact.

FAQs

1. Can I set up a gas hob and an electrical oven in the exact same kitchen?

Yes, numerous kitchen areas are developed to accommodate various kinds of devices. However, ensure that your kitchen area's gas line and electrical systems can deal with the home appliances' requirements.

2. Which is better: gas or induction hobs?

This mostly depends on individual preference. Gas hobs offer instantaneous heat and are often preferred by chefs for their precise temperature level control. Induction hobs, on the other hand, are more energy-efficient and provide fast heating, however need compatible cookware.

3. How often should I clean my oven and hob?

It is recommended to clean your oven every 3-6 months, depending on use. Hobs should be wiped down after each use to avoid the accumulation of food residue and spills.

4. Can I use aluminum foil in my oven?

In general, yes. Nevertheless, prevent covering vents or the oven bottom, as this can limit air flow and trigger overheating.

5. How can I avoid my oven from smoking cigarettes?

Routinely cleaning your oven can assist prevent cigarette smoking. In addition, avoid placing food that is too oily or dripping directly on the oven bottom.
